    Help - bad nappy rash

    Hi guys,

    What is the best thing to use for nappy rash? I have zinc and castor but not really effective. First time we have had this (10 mths old) and it is red red red!

    Hi

    I have used Diprotex on Ally and it is great, you can get it at Watsons and most dispensaries. Also have you tried just leaving the diaper off for a while each day for a bit of airing, I know it is tricky but should also help. I normally just put a shower curtain underneath a blanket or sheet so you don't have to worry about any accidents. Good luck i hope your little one gets some relief soon.

    my boy has had it for the past week... he's 6.5 months and it is the first time he's had it...

    i did some research on the internet and found that a little good old cornstarch (dry) in a clean dry nappy has done wonders... as has desitin cream... it was so bad on wednesday that i considered taking him to the doctor. that's when i did the looking on the internet... today it's almost gone!
